A liquid solution is formed by mixing 10 moles of aniline and 20 moles of phenol at a temperature where the vapour pressures of pure liquid aniline and phenol are 90 and 87 mm Hg, respectively. The possible vapour pressure of solution at that temperature is
Answer: A
π‘ Solution & Explanation
Aniline and phenol form strong H-bonds β negative deviation from Raoult's law. Ideal P = 90 Γ (1/3) + 87 Γ (2/3) = 88 mm Hg. Actual P < 88 mm Hg β only (a) 82 mm Hg is possible.
